Working Memory
Working memory is a cognitive system responsible for temporarily holding and processing information needed for complex tasks like learning, reasoning, and comprehension.
Knowledge Base
A centralized repository of information, often in a computer system, that allows for the storage, retrieval, and management of data, facts, and information.
Intelligence
The ability to learn, understand, and make judgments or have opinions that are based on reason.
Information Processing Capabilities
Refers to the cognitive functions involved in processing, storing, and retrieving information, often likened to how computers process data.
